D. 12
Step-by-step explanation:
Based on the Angle Bisector theorem, the opposite sides of ∆ABC are divided into proportional segments alongside the two other sides of the triangle, as BD bisects the <ABC. This implies that:
AB/AD = CB/CD
Substitute
AB/8 = 6/4
Cross multiply
AB*4 = 6*8
AB*4 = 48
AB = 48/4
AB = 12
The equation of the line is 5y = 6x + 8 which passes through point C and perpendicular AB.
<h3>What is the slope?</h3>
The ratio that y increase as x increases is the slope of a line. The slope of a line reflects how steep it is, but how much y increases as x increases. Anywhere on the line, the slope stays unchanged (the same).
![\rm m =\dfrac{y_2-y_1}{x_2-x_1}](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=%5Crm%20m%20%3D%5Cdfrac%7By_2-y_1%7D%7Bx_2-x_1%7D)
We have a triangle ABC is defined by the points A(2,9), B(8,4), and C(-3,-2).
The slope of the segment AB:
![\rm m =\dfrac{4-9}{8-2}](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=%5Crm%20m%20%3D%5Cdfrac%7B4-9%7D%7B8-2%7D)
m = -5/6
The slope of the line perpendicular to AB:
Let M is the slope of the line:
mM = -1
(-5/6)M = -1
M = 6/5
The line:
y = Mx + c
y = (6/5)x + c
The line passing through the point C(-3, -2)
-2 = (6/5)(-3) + c
c = 8/5
y = (6/5)x + 8/5
5y = 6x + 8
Thus, the equation of the line is 5y = 6x + 8 which passes through point C and perpendicular AB.
